Text of marker:

Matthews Block
Thomas Newton Matthews was originally from Texas, owned property in Wyoming and lived in Spearfish.  In 1900 he began construction on a large commercial building on the northeast corner of Main and Hudson Streets.  Just as construction was finished he decided to expand.  His plans included stores on the first level of the new building, apartments, offices and an opera house on the second level.  The expansion was completed in 1906 and composed of native sandstone and brick.  In later years Thomas Newton's son, Thomas William removed the seats from the opera house so that it could be used for a dance floor.  Silent movies were shown in the opera house in the 1920's.  During the 1970's a local production of "The Phantom of Matthew's Opera House" was performed every summer.  A complete renovation of the opera house, which was completed in 1997, added a lobby and modern facilities.
